Witching hour cocktail

This silky cocktail features tequila, chai tea and velvety espresso
witching hour cocktail

When the clock strikes midnight, we know what we’ll want to hand: an enticing glass of this witching hour cocktail, provided by Aaron Lee Mander of The Dark Horse in Bath

Serves    1
  • Tapatio Anejo Tequila 30ml
  • Henny & Joe’s Chai Tea 20ml
  • Fresh espresso 20ml
  • Agave nectar 5ml
  1. Shake all ingredients vigorously with ice.
  2. Pour into a chilled Nick & Nora glass (pictured) or similar.
